HSRP tracking

Hi Expert,

We have implemented hsrp in our networ. We are using HSRP tracking functionality  ( tracking serial interface). I want to know how much time standy router take to get active state when serial link get down.

Q. Will the standby router take over if the active router LAN interface state is "interface up line protocol down"?



A. Yes, the standby router takes over once the holdtime  expires. By default, this is equivalent to three hello packets from the  active router having been missed. The actual convergence time depends on  the HSRP timers configured for the group and possibly on routing  protocol convergence. The HSRP hellotime timer defaults to three and the  holdtime timer defaults to ten
